Program Overview

Supercharge your career prospects by becoming equipped with high-level professional skills. The Master of Information and Communications Technology will develop your understanding in data analytics, data science engineering, data and process management, domain knowledge and research methods.


In this program you will:

  • Understand the ethical implications with respect to privacy and security in the analysis and use of data
  • Understand how the effective management and use of data has, and will continue, to transform organisations through digital innovation
  • Apply research methods and skills to develop innovative solutions to business problems

General Admission Requirement

    Academic Requirement

    • Minimum Level of Education Required: To be considered for admission, candidates require completion of a recognised bachelor's degree from a recognised higher education institution or equivalent or successful completion of a Graduate Certificate in ICT or Graduate Certificate in Cyber Security.
       
    • Students who have completed a bachelor's degree in information and communication technology may be eligible to apply for 48 units of block credit. The 48 units (four courses) credited will be determined by the courses students have completed and will be assessed on a case-by-case basis.

    Scholarships

    At UniSC, we offer a range of scholarship opportunities to our international students. In addition to the scholarships listed below, international students should also check with their home institution and government to find out if other scholarship options are available to them.


    International Student Scholarship

    The International Student Scholarship is a 15% tuition fee reduction offered to commencing international students in 2025.

    Terms and Conditions

    • The International Student Scholarship, International Bright Futures Scholarship and the English Excellence Scholarship apply to the officially scheduled and published tuition fees for the relevant program and study period.
    • The International Student Scholarship, International Bright Futures Scholarship and the English Excellence Scholarship are available to international students commencing in 2025. They cannot be deferred past a 2025 intake.
    • The International Student Scholarship,International Bright Futures Scholarship and the English Excellence Scholarship are valid for the duration of the program/s for which an offer was made.
    • The International Bright Futures Scholarship applies to programs that are new to UniSC International and launched within a certain time frame. For information about programs that have been newly launched, please contact UniSC International.
    • To be eligible for the English Excellence Scholarship, students must achieve the minimum specified result outlined in the English Excellence Scholarship requirements table in one of three recognised English proficiency tests: IELTS Academic, TOEFL iBT, or PTE. The English Excellence Scholarship is not available to students enrolling in a UniSC English language program.
    • Neither the International Student Scholarship, International Bright Futures Scholarship nor the English Excellence Scholarship can be used in conjunction with each other nor any other UniSC international scholarships or tuition fee reductions (e.g. partner discount).
    • To remain eligible for the International Student Scholarship, International Bright Futures Scholarship or the English Excellence Scholarship, students must continue to be classed as international students.
